I was given a choice...
Either 1) have my Z left at the port until the spoiler arrived, or 2) ship the Z to the dealer immediately, and have them install the spoiler when the spoiler came in.
I trust my dealer. They are fantastic. I asked them to go with #2, and ship the Z right away. By going with #2, I will get my Z (sans the rear spoiler) until the part arrives. I am very happy with my dealership.
To answer your question, they said it was my choice on what I wanted done. Because there was no clear ETA on the spoiler arrival, I went with #2. The dealership was going to contact NNA and indicate my Z should not wait for the missing part.
I talked to NNA. They told me that the front spoiler may possibly be installed, even if the rear is not. The two pieces of the spoiler (front/rear) are from two different vendors.
I am impressed with Nissan regarding this issue.
